Zihang Liang is a planetary geologist whose research focuses on the detection and characterization of subsurface voids on Mars, particularly lava tube skylights and cave candidates. Their most notable contribution is the first comprehensive investigation of a potential subsurface lava tube skylight on the western flank of Elysium Mons, Mars, identified as a high-priority cave candidate in the Mars Cave Catalog. By integrating high-resolution imagery and thermal analysis, Liang's work provides critical evidence for the existence of stable, accessible subsurface cavities—key targets for future habitation and astrobiological exploration.
